We are seeking a skilled CAD Drafter with expertise in AutoCAD and Rhino to join our dynamic design team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for creating detailed technical drawings and 3D models to support architectural, engineering, or product design projects. This role requires precision, creativity, and a strong understanding of design principles to produce high-quality deliverables that meet project specifications and industry standards.
- Develop accurate 2D technical drawings and 3D models using AutoCAD and Rhino based on project requirements, sketches, or specifications.
- Collaborate with architects, engineers, and designers to interpret design concepts and translate them into detailed CAD drawings.
- Ensure drawings comply with industry standards, building codes, and client specifications.
- Modify and revise designs based on feedback from project stakeholders or designers.
- Prepare detailed documentation, including plans, elevations, sections, and detail drawings for construction or manufacturing.
- Perform quality checks to ensure accuracy, completeness, and consistency of drawings.
- Assist in creating presentations, renderings, or visualizations using Rhino's rendering capabilities or related plugins.
- Maintain organized project files and documentation for easy access and reference.
- Stay updated on the latest CAD software features, tools, and industry trends to improve efficiency and output quality.
